实时可视化猪模型对抽吸血栓切除术性能的影响:靶向血管大小的作用

Impact of Target Artery Size on the Performance of Aspiration Thrombectomy: Insights from a Swine Model with Real-Time Visualization.

AJNR Am J Neuroradiol. 2024 Jun 7;45(6):727-730. doi: 10.3174/ajnr.A8198.

Abstract

A novel swine model was developed to investigate the underlying reasons for the failure of aspiration thrombectomy. The model allows direct visualization of the target artery during thrombectomy in vessels of different sizes. The behavior of the target artery undergoing aspiration thrombectomy was recorded with high-resolution digital microscopy and fluoroscopic visualization, providing valuable insight into how the different sizes of treated arteries affect the effectiveness of mechanical thrombectomy.
